Address

ecash:qp9mflmekf32nqwn7f4f70qhpmfdg68n5yxm8zeqtrCopy

Total Received

17034007.47 XEC

Total Sent

17034007.47 XEC

№ Transactions

397

Final Balance

0 XEC

Transactions
Filter